Definition of Homeless Shelters
Homeless shelters are temporary residential facilities that offer accommodation to individuals and families who do not have a stable place to stay. These shelters can vary in size and capacity and may provide additional services such as meals, showers, and support programs to assist their guests in getting back on their feet.
Purpose of Homeless Shelters
The main purpose of homeless shelters is to provide a safe and secure place for homeless individuals and families to stay while they work on improving their situation. These shelters provide a roof over their heads, along with access to services and resources that can help them find jobs, secure permanent housing, and address any health or mental health issues they may be experiencing.
Types of Homeless Shelters
There are several types of homeless shelters, including emergency shelters, day centres, transitional housing, and permanent supportive housing. Emergency shelters provide short-term accommodation for individuals and families in crisis, while day centres offer services and amenities during the day. Transitional housing offers a temporary home for those who have already secured employment and are working towards permanent housing. And permanent supportive housing is designed for those with long-term or chronic homelessness and provides ongoing support services to help them maintain their stability.
Services Provided by Homeless Shelters
Typically, homeless shelters offer a range of services to support their guests. These may include meals, showers and hygiene facilities, laundry facilities, clothing donations, counselling services, case management, job training, and educational programs. Some shelters may also provide medical and mental health services, addiction treatment, and legal assistance.
Eligibility Criteria for Homeless Shelters
The eligibility criteria for homeless shelters can vary depending on the type of shelter, its location, and available resources. Generally, shelters require guests to be homeless or at risk of homelessness, and to demonstrate a willingness to work towards securing permanent housing, employment, and stability. They may also require identification documents, proof of income or unemployment, and references.
Funding and Operational Structure of Homeless Shelters
Homeless shelters typically rely on funding from a variety of sources, including government grants, private donations, and fundraising efforts. Some may be operated by non-profit organizations, while others may be run by the government or faith-based organizations. Staffing may include paid employees, volunteers, and interns, with programs and services overseen by a board of directors or other governing body.
Collaboration with Public Sector and Society
Homeless shelters often work closely with public sector organizations such as local councils and housing authorities, as well as with community groups, charities, and businesses. They may collaborate on funding applications, service provision, and advocacy efforts to address the root causes of homelessness, such as poverty, lack of affordable housing, and mental health issues.
Impact of Homeless Shelters on the Community
Homeless shelters can have a positive impact on the wider community by providing a range of services and support to those experiencing homelessness. They can help reduce the rates of street homelessness, improve the health and well-being of their guests, and offer a pathway to economic stability and permanent housing. They can also raise awareness about issues of poverty and homelessness, and foster empathy and understanding among local residents.
